Output 3d7c25cccc9d8c4226e515b9d9fa94cf4ab3adc34d57e278dd01607345703863:1

value
2875598
script pubkey
OP_0 OP_PUSHBYTES_20 73efde56ddfb84ba9e52aeacc1e53d094ebc155a
address
bc1qw0hau4kalwzt48jj46kvrefap98tc926crx2tf
transaction
3d7c25cccc9d8c4226e515b9d9fa94cf4ab3adc34d57e278dd01607345703863
confirmations
360708
spent
true